How NHS West Sussex is run
The Board
The Board’s role is to oversee the organisation’s work and ensure decisions about changes to local health services are openly debated.
It provides leadership, looks ahead and outlines NHS West Sussex’s strategic aims.
Board meetings
From the 1st June 2011 NHS West Sussex became part of a cluster covering East Sussex, Brighton and Hove and West Sussex.
There is now one NHS Sussex Board considering issues relating to all three areas.
Therefore Board dates have been changed to those below:
